Information Technology’s Research Computing, in partnership with the University of Florida, and Florida State received a grant through the New Florida Initiative program of the Board of Governors. This initiative is a multi-year endeavor that, “… will ensure that Florida’s knowledge and innovation economy is sustained by high-technology, high-wage jobs in the fields of science, technology, engineering and mathematics (or “STEM”).”
The grant will provide funding for the Sunshine Grid: Florida’s Research and Education Cyberinfrastructure. This project will begin the process of creating a coherent core infrastructure for the state of Florida to promote and support research and education.
